 - namespace Doctrine\DBAL\Query\Expression;
 - 
 - use Doctrine\DBAL\Connection;
 - 
 - /**
 -  * ExpressionBuilder class is responsible to dynamically create SQL query parts.
 -  *
 -  * @license     http://www.opensource.org/licenses/lgpl-license.php LGPL
 -  * @link        www.doctrine-project.com
 -  * @since       2.1
 -  * @author      Guilherme Blanco <guilhermeblanco@hotmail.com>
 -  * @author      Benjamin Eberlei <kontakt@beberlei.de>
 -  */
 - class ExpressionBuilder
 - {
 -     const EQ  = '=';
 -     const NEQ = '<>';
 -     const LT  = '<';
 -     const LTE = '<=';
 -     const GT  = '>';
 -     const GTE = '>=';
 -     
 -     /**
 -      * @var Doctrine\DBAL\Connection DBAL Connection
 -      */
 -     private $connection = null;
 - 
 -     /**
 -      * Initializes a new <tt>ExpressionBuilder</tt>.
 -      *
 -      * @param Doctrine\DBAL\Connection $connection DBAL Connection
 -      */
 -     public function __construct(Connection $connection)
 -     {
 -         $this->connection = $connection;
 -     }
 -     
 -     /**
 -      * Creates a conjunction of the given boolean expressions.
 -      *
 -      * Example:
 -      *
 -      *     [php]
 -      *     // (u.type = ?) AND (u.role = ?)
 -      *     $expr->andX('u.type = ?', 'u.role = ?'));
 -      *
 -      * @param mixed $x Optional clause. Defaults = null, but requires
 -      *                 at least one defined when converting to string.
 -      * @return CompositeExpression
 -      */
 -     public function andX($x = null)
 -     {
 -         return new CompositeExpression(CompositeExpression::TYPE_AND, func_get_args());
 -     }
 - 
 -     /**
 -      * Creates a disjunction of the given boolean expressions.
 -      *
 -      * Example:
 -      *
 -      *     [php]
 -      *     // (u.type = ?) OR (u.role = ?)
 -      *     $qb->where($qb->expr()->orX('u.type = ?', 'u.role = ?'));
 -      *
 -      * @param mixed $x Optional clause. Defaults = null, but requires
 -      *                 at least one defined when converting to string.
 -      * @return CompositeExpression
 -      */
 -     public function orX($x = null)
 -     {
 -         return new CompositeExpression(CompositeExpression::TYPE_OR, func_get_args());
 -     }
 - 
 -     /**
 -      * Creates a comparison expression.
 -      * 
 -      * @param mixed $x Left expression
 -      * @param string $operator One of the ExpressionBuikder::* constants.
 -      * @param mixed $y Right expression
 -      * @return string
 -      */
 -     public function comparison($x, $operator, $y)
 -     {
 -         return $x . ' ' . $operator . ' ' . $y;
 -     }
 -     
 -     /**
 -      * Creates an equality comparison expression with the given arguments.
 -      *
 -      * First argument is considered the left expression and the second is the right expression.
 -      * When converted to string, it will generated a <left expr> = <right expr>. Example:
 -      *
 -      *     [php]
 -      *     // u.id = ?
 -      *     $expr->eq('u.id', '?');
 -      *
 -      * @param mixed $x Left expression
 -      * @param mixed $y Right expression
 -      * @return string
 -      */
 -     public function eq($x, $y)
 -     {
 -         return $this->comparison($x, self::EQ, $y);
 -     }
 - 
 -     /**
 -      * Creates a non equality comparison expression with the given arguments.
 -      * First argument is considered the left expression and the second is the right expression.
 -      * When converted to string, it will generated a <left expr> <> <right expr>. Example:
 -      *
 -      *     [php]
 -      *     // u.id <> 1
 -      *     $q->where($q->expr()->neq('u.id', '1'));
 -      *
 -      * @param mixed $x Left expression
 -      * @param mixed $y Right expression
 -      * @return string
 -      */
 -     public function neq($x, $y)
 -     {
 -         return $this->comparison($x, self::NEQ, $y);
 -     }
 - 
 -     /**
 -      * Creates a lower-than comparison expression with the given arguments.
 -      * First argument is considered the left expression and the second is the right expression.
 -      * When converted to string, it will generated a <left expr> < <right expr>. Example:
 -      *
 -      *     [php]
 -      *     // u.id < ?
 -      *     $q->where($q->expr()->lt('u.id', '?'));
 -      *
 -      * @param mixed $x Left expression
 -      * @param mixed $y Right expression
 -      * @return string
 -      */
 -     public function lt($x, $y)
 -     {
 -         return $this->comparison($x, self::LT, $y);
 -     }
 - 
 -     /**
 -      * Creates a lower-than-equal comparison expression with the given arguments.
 -      * First argument is considered the left expression and the second is the right expression.
 -      * When converted to string, it will generated a <left expr> <= <right expr>. Example:
 -      *
 -      *     [php]
 -      *     // u.id <= ?
 -      *     $q->where($q->expr()->lte('u.id', '?'));
 -      *
 -      * @param mixed $x Left expression
 -      * @param mixed $y Right expression
 -      * @return string
 -      */
 -     public function lte($x, $y)
 -     {
 -         return $this->comparison($x, self::LTE, $y);
 -     }
 - 
 -     /**
 -      * Creates a greater-than comparison expression with the given arguments.
 -      * First argument is considered the left expression and the second is the right expression.
 -      * When converted to string, it will generated a <left expr> > <right expr>. Example:
 -      *
 -      *     [php]
 -      *     // u.id > ?
 -      *     $q->where($q->expr()->gt('u.id', '?'));
 -      *
 -      * @param mixed $x Left expression
 -      * @param mixed $y Right expression
 -      * @return string
 -      */
 -     public function gt($x, $y)
 -     {
 -         return $this->comparison($x, self::GT, $y);
 -     }
 - 
 -     /**
 -      * Creates a greater-than-equal comparison expression with the given arguments.
 -      * First argument is considered the left expression and the second is the right expression.
 -      * When converted to string, it will generated a <left expr> >= <right expr>. Example:
 -      *
 -      *     [php]
 -      *     // u.id >= ?
 -      *     $q->where($q->expr()->gte('u.id', '?'));
 -      *
 -      * @param mixed $x Left expression
 -      * @param mixed $y Right expression
 -      * @return string
 -      */
 -     public function gte($x, $y)
 -     {
 -         return $this->comparison($x, self::GTE, $y);
 -     }
 - 
 -     /**
 -      * Creates an IS NULL expression with the given arguments.
 -      *
 -      * @param string $x Field in string format to be restricted by IS NULL
 -      * 
 -      * @return string
 -      */
 -     public function isNull($x)
 -     {
 -         return $x . ' IS NULL';
 -     }
 - 
 -     /**
 -      * Creates an IS NOT NULL expression with the given arguments.
 -      *
 -      * @param string $x Field in string format to be restricted by IS NOT NULL
 -      * 
 -      * @return string
 -      */
 -     public function isNotNull($x)
 -     {
 -         return $x . ' IS NOT NULL';
 -     }
 - 
 -     /**
 -      * Creates a LIKE() comparison expression with the given arguments.
 -      *
 -      * @param string $x Field in string format to be inspected by LIKE() comparison.
 -      * @param mixed $y Argument to be used in LIKE() comparison.
 -      * 
 -      * @return string
 -      */
 -     public function like($x, $y)
 -     {
 -         return $this->comparison($x, 'LIKE', $y);
 -     }
 -     
 -     /**
 -      * Quotes a given input parameter.
 -      * 
 -      * @param mixed $input Parameter to be quoted.
 -      * @param string $type Type of the parameter.
 -      * 
 -      * @return string
 -      */
 -     public function literal($input, $type = null)
 -     {
 -         return $this->connection->quote($input, $type);
 -     }
 - }
